Transaction 96aa9110b07ed03b505444d72178fb1df059b2cd3dd8d5a2233d5e95bc8685aa
1 Input
1 Output
-
96aa9110b07ed03b505444d72178fb1df059b2cd3dd8d5a2233d5e95bc8685aa:0
- value
- 7407714
- script pubkey
- OP_0 OP_PUSHBYTES_20 77912c990852cd2a5e4a4f3c38cfbbff59285b6d
- address
- bc1qw7gjexgg2txj5hj2fu7r3namlavjskmdr9wvd0